EACA Announces New Directors/Officers for 2006-07.        The EACA announced its new Directors and Officers for 2006-07 at the Annual Meeting in Chicago last week.
 
The Officers for 2006-07 are President - Steve Hagstette, Freeman; Vice President - Susan Renner, The Term Group; Treasurer - Ron Mestichelli, Spectrum Show Services;  Secretary – Bernie Massett, MC2; and Immediate Past President – David Mihalik, EliteXPO Cargo Systems.
 
The Directors for 2006-07, in addition to the previously mentioned Officers are Bruce Cantwell, On Location, Scott Bennett, Nth Degree, Peter Eelman, IMTS, Anthony Lopez, MPEA, Michael Hardeman, IUPAT Local 510, Dennis Christensen, GES, and Geri-Dee Shaffer. Aesculap.
 
The EACA congratulates all its Officers and Directors as we look forward to a productive and prosperous 2006-07 for the association.

IMTS Block Package Pricing.   New for IMTS in 2006 is a a package of services including carpet, visqueen, cleaning, drayage, rigging labor and equipment and standard furniture. This Custom Block Package applies to all exhibitors.    
A note to all EACA members is that the Custom Block Package cannot be broken up where part is paid by a third party and part by the exhibitor, or by multiple third parties.     However, a third party can be authorized and take the entire billing.       Any EACA member that plans to make such arrangements for a client at IMTS must first submit their third party authorization form.

E3: Goodbye Massive Expo, Hello Meetings  <Tradeshow Week>  The Entertainment Software Assn. plans to evolve its E3/Electronic Entertainment Expo into a more intimate event in 2007. The annual gathering, to remain in Los Angeles , will focus on press events and small meetings and will have opportunities for game demonstrations.
 
ATTENDANCE JUMPS AT A SUCCESSFUL TS2 2006
    Chicago, IL August 1, 2006 – National Trade Productions (NTP), producers of TS2 and the Trade Show Exhibitors Association (TSEA), sponsors of the event, are reporting a 13% increase in verified attendees to a total of 2,735 and a 24% increase in conference attendees at the event. Exhibit and event managers from around the country gathered at TS2 during “Trade Show Week” in the State of Illinois , which was proclaimed by Governor Rod Blagojevich in honor of TS2 and its impact on the trade show industry. TS2 has seen a 36% increase of verified net attendees since NTP took over the event in 2005

United sells London routes to Delta.    <M&C Midweek News>  United Airlines will sell its nonstop service between New York 's John F. Kennedy International Airport and London 's Gatwick Airport to Delta Air Lines. The agreement, subject to Department of Transportation approval, will allow Delta to operate daily roundtrip flights to England by the end of this year.
